2-ma’ruza: ma’lumotlar bazasini loyihalashtirish bosqichlari ma’lumotlar modeli reja
Download 50.61 Kb.
|
2-MA\'RUZA
- Bu sahifa navigatsiya:
- Ma’lumotlarning iyerarxik strukturasi.
- Ma’lumotlar ustida ish yuritish
2-MA’RUZA: MA’LUMOTLAR BAZASINI LOYIHALASHTIRISH BOSQICHLARI. MA’LUMOTLAR MODELI REJA: Iyerarxik tizimlar Tarmoqli tizimlar Tayanch so’z va iboralar: Tizim, iyerarxik, tarmoqli, relyatsion 2.1. IYERARXIK TIZIMLAR IBM firmasining Informatsion Management System (IMS)tizimi (ko‘p tarqalgan va taniqli) tipik vakili bo‘ladi. Uning birinchi varianti 1968-yilda paydo bo‘lgan. Hozirgacha ko‘pgina ma’lumotlar bazasi u bilan ishlash imkoniyatiga ega. Bu MB da yangi texnologiyaga va yangi texnikaga o‘tishda yetarlicha muammolarni hal qilishga olib keladi. Ma’lumotlarning iyerarxik strukturasi. Iyerarxik MB tartiblangan daraxtlar to‘plamidan tuziladi.Yanada aniqrog‘i, bir xil turdagi daraxtlarning bir nechta tartiblangan nusxalari to‘plamidan iborat bo‘ladi. Daraxt turi bitta“ildizli” tur yozuvidan va tartiblangan bitta yoki bir nechta daraxt osti turlaridan (ular har biri daraxtning turidir) tashkil topadi. Daraxt turi umuman olganda iyerarxik ravishda tashkil topgan yozuvlar turlari to‘plamini tasvirlaydi. Daraxt turiga misol: 1 Bu yerda “Rahbar” va “Xodimlar” uchun “Bo‘lim” ajdodbo‘lib, “Rahbar” va “Xodimlar” esa “Bo‘lim” (avlodlari)davomchilaridir. Yozuv turlari orasida bog‘lanish mavjud.Bunday sxemadagi ma’lumotlar bazasi quyidagi ko‘rinishda tasvirlanadi (daraxtning bitta nusxasi ko‘rsatilayapti): Barcha (avlod) davomchi turdagi nusxalar (ajdod) oldingi turdagi umumiy nusxalar bilan yaqin, ya’ni egizak deyiladi. MBuchun pastdan yuqoriga, chapdan o‘ngga o‘tish tartibi to‘liq aniqlangan. IMS da original va standart bo‘lmagan terminlar ishlatilgan:“сегмент” o‘rnida “yozuv”, hamda “MB yozuvi” tushunchasida barcha daraxtlar sigmenti tushuniladi. Ma’lumotlar ustida ish yuritish Iyerarxik tashkil qilingan ma’lumotlar bilan ish yuritishda quyidagi operatorlarni misol tariqasida namuna qilib olish mumkin: MBdako‘rsatilgan daraxtni topish; bir daraxtdan ikkinchisiga o‘tish; bitta yozuvdan boshqa daraxt ichiga kirish (masalan, bo‘lim-dan — birinchi xodimga); 9 bitta yozuvdan ierarxiya tartibida boshqasiga o‘tish; yangi yozuvni ko‘rsatilgan o‘ringa qo‘yish; joriy yozuvni o‘chirish; butunlikni chegaralash. Avlod va ajdodlar o‘rtasidagi murojaatlar yaxlitligi avtomatik tarzda qo‘llab-quvvatlanadi. Asosiy qoidalar: hech bir avlod o‘z ota-onasisiz mavjud bo‘lmaydi. Shuni ta’kidlash kerakki, shunga o‘xshash bir ierarxiyaga kirmaydigan yozuvlar orasidagi murojaatlar yaxlitligini qo‘llab bo‘lmaydi (bunda tashqi murojaatning misoli sifatida, Kaf nomeri maydoni tarkibiga kiruvchi Kurator yozuvi turi nusxasi bo‘lishi mumkin). Iyerarxik tizimlarda MB tasvirlaydigan forma iyerarxiyaga qo‘yilgan cheklashlar asosida qo‘llanadi.Yuqorida keltirilganMB namoyishi sifatida quyidagi iyerarxiyani keltirish mumkin. Download 50.61 Kb. Do'stlaringiz bilan baham: |
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ling
ma'muriyatiga murojaat qiling